The much awaited cooperation between director Puri Jagannath and acclaimed actor Vijay Sethupati has officially come on the floor. The producers announced on Monday that filming has started in Hyderabad, with a busy program to shoot the main talkies on Vijay Sethupati and the leading female Samyukta.
Production House, Puri Connects resorted to social media to share updates, which wrote: “And it has started! The All India Film will be released in five languages- Telugu, Tamil, Hindi, Kannada and Malayalam, which has increased expectations.
The shooting of the film originally began in the end of June began this week after a wide place Reiki in Hyderabad and Chennai. The film is being produced by Puri Jagannath under the Puri Connects banner and is being presented by Charmme Kaur in collaboration with JB Motion Pictures and JB Narayan Rao Kondrola.
Samyukta, who plays a female-oriented role, is allegedly excited about her emotionally rich and performing role. She acts with Vijay Sethupati, while experienced actress Tabu and Vijay Kumar will appear in important supporting roles.
Puri Jagannath, known for his high-energy story and public appeal, is said to be mixing his trademark style with Vijay Sethupati’s magnetic screen appearance. The result is expected to be a unique commercial entertaining film that will be full of raw feelings and dynamic performances.
